The Science: Why Steel-Reinforcement Matters for Rectangle Planters

Longer planters are particularly susceptible to "bellying"—a phenomenon where the weight of heavy, wet soil forces the long side-walls to bulge outward. This ruins the crisp, architectural silhouette. To prevent this, NMN Designs integrates internal steel reinforcement into the Julian Rectangle.

This engineering ensures that even when housing a dense row of plants, the walls remain perfectly plumb and vertical. Combined with our commercial-grade fiberglass, you get a vessel that handles extreme thermal expansion (from scorching summers to sub-zero winters) without the cracking or brittleness found in standard retail pots.


Recommended Plant Pairings for the 30" Julian:

The 12" depth of the Julian requires a thoughtful selection of root-compatible plants. We recommend the following for health, aesthetics, and performance:

For Privacy and Height (Narrow Profile Specialists):

  • Sky Pencil Holly: The gold standard for 12" troughs. Its naturally columnar shape stays narrow and vertical without needing heavy pruning, providing a "living wall" effect.

  • Blue Arrow Juniper: A stunning, silvery-blue evergreen that is much more drought-tolerant and narrow-root-compatible than traditional Arborvitae.

For High-Contrast Color:

  • Red Star Cordyline: Features deep burgundy, sword-like leaves that look striking against the Matte Black finish.

  • Golden Creeping Jenny (as a "Spiller"): Plant these at the edges to create a vibrant, lime-green "waterfall" of foliage that pops against the dark fiberglass.

For Extreme Temperatures (Heat, Wind, and Frost):

  • Karl Foerster Feather Reed Grass: Virtually "bulletproof." It handles sub-zero winters and scorching summers with ease. Its tall, wheat-like stalks provide privacy and movement in the wind.

  • Green Mountain Boxwood: Extremely cold-hardy and classic. It can be easily maintained to fit the 12" width and provides a structured, formal look year-round.


Pro-Tips for the Best Results

  • High-Wind Stability: For exposed roof decks or coastal balconies, add 3 inches of heavy gravel at the base before adding soil. This lowers the center of gravity, ensuring your privacy screen stays upright during heavy gusts.

  • Thermal Protection: While the fiberglass is frost-proof, using an insulated liner inside the planter in extreme northern climates can help protect the root balls of perennial plants, ensuring they return season after season.

I have an Onkyo audio/video receiver along with an Emotiva amplifier. Both have speaker "post" terminals which will accept banana plugs, OR I can connect the speaker wires by unscrewing the posts, poke the speaker wires into the terminals and then tighten the posts. The problem with poking the wires into the terminals and tightening the posts vs using banana plugs is that there is a risk of the wires touching the metal on the back of the chassis or touching other speaker wires, causing a short if one is not careful. With banana plugs, they simply plug into the back/top of the posts, eliminating the rsick of a short circuit. They can also be unplugged very easily if needed. Banana plugs are DEFINITELY the preferred way to connect speakers to an receiver or amplifier if they have post-style terminals. These particular banana plugs came in a package of 12 I believe. They were very reasonably priced, and simple to connect to the end of the speaker wires. Simply unscrew the banana plugs, use a small, standard jewelry screwdriver and loosen both of the set screws, insert the speaker wire, then tighten the set screws, and then screw the banana plug back together. The plugs have either a red band which would typically be used for your "Right" speakers, or a black band which would typically be used for the "left" speakers. The banana plugs insert into the top or front of the speaker terminal posts on the amp and receiver. They fit VERY snug, and so I did have to apply just a little bit of pressure in order to insert them into the posts, but once plugged in, rest assured they're not going anywhere. They are snug.
